I applied for 489 state nomination to the NT as general electrician with 60 points in february.

Points are not a huge part in state sponsorship. If you are firstly granted the individual state nomination application, you will receive an automatic visa invitation. Some states require a direct application for the nomination part before your invited for the visa. The nomination application is were most people fail as the state requirements change frequently. Your occupation needs to be on the individual states list.
